This is the easiest and best (and only) sorbet I've ever made! (I'm not sure it should count as a recipe and I can't remember where I got the idea, but it's a good one!) No ice cream maker required! (Can also be done with other berries/fruits.) Ingredients:
2 (12 ounce) bags frozen unsweetened raspberries, still frozen |
mint sprig (optional) |
sugar (optional) or shortbread cookie (optional) |
Directions:
1. Put 1/2 of the raspberries in a food processor (or 1/8 of the raspberries in a blender) and pulse until pureed. 2. Put the raspberry mush into a plastic container and continue with the next batch of raspberries. 3. Freeze the container for 30 minutes. 4. Scoop out the sorbet and serve! 5. Great with sugar cookies or shortbread and garnished with fresh mint. |
